Case Studies on Human Rights

FREE

2007
32 pages
ISBN: 978 1 876045 40 1
Written by Allen Clayton-Greene and David Thomson

About

This collection of case studies is designed for teachers to promote discussion with VCE students on the role of the Commonwealth Constitution and its importance in protecting democratic and human rights.

Includes teaching guidelines, student tasks and a sample assessment.

Produced in partnership with Liberty Victoria.
